Pakke ki Madaiyān
Pakke ki Madaiyān is a locality in Gunnaur, Sambhal District, Uttar Pradesh. Pakke ki Madaiyān is situated nearby to the locality Bhopatpur, as well as near Basantpur.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Gawan
Town
Gawan is a town and a nagar panchayat in Sambhal district in the state of Uttar Pradesh, India. There is holy palace known as Hari Baba Bandh and it is near the Ganges River. Gawan is situated 6 km northeast of Pakke ki Madaiyān.
